KACE Names Mike Regan Vice President of Customer Service & Operations
Former Siebel, Sybase Executive Brings KACE Extensive Experience and Track Record of Building World-class Customer Services Organizations within Rapidly Growing Businesses
MOUNTAIN VIEW, Calif. – May 20, 2008 – KACE™, the leading systems management appliance company, today announced the appointment of Mike Regan as the company’s vice president of customer service and operations. Regan brings 25 years of experience in creating global, customer-focused organizations for a variety of high-growth companies. In the newly created position, Regan will be charged with ensuring that KACE’s customer support, training, and product fulfillment teams are aligned in providing customers and partners with world class services.
“We are excited to welcome Regan as the latest addition to our executive team,” said Rob Meinhardt, co-founder and CEO of KACE. “He brings a great breadth of knowledge and customer service experience to KACE, which will help to drive our leadership in the systems management market.”
Regan joins KACE from MarketLive, Inc., where he served as senior vice president of professional services for its mid-market e-commerce solutions. In that role, he revamped the professional services business and established standardized technical support processes to increase customer satisfaction and drive profitability. Prior to MarketLive, Mike held executive professional services management positions at Siebel Systems, Sybase, Datasweep, and Portal Software.
“KACE is offering midsized enterprises another choice in systems management—one that is easy-to-use, comprehensive, and affordable. This appliance-based approach is long overdue as witnessed by KACE’s explosive customer group,” said Regan. “These are exciting times for KACE and the industry, and I’m eager to be a part of it.”

Robert Abbott
Since joining Norwest Venture Partners in 1998, Mr. Abbott has focused primarily on enterprise software and communication technologies. Mr. Abbott sits on the board of mBlox (formerly MobileSys), Occam Networks and ClariPhy and actively works with Open-Silicon. He has also worked with such companies as Embark, Escalate, mPower (acquired by Morningstar), Quantum Effect Devices (acquired by PMC-Sierra), Silicon Access, Summit Microelectronics and Think3. Mr. Abbott was formerly a member of the board of directors of Covigo (acquired by Symbol Technologies) and Resonext Communications (acquired by RF Micro Devices).
Mr. Abbott has nine years of operational experience in various roles, from engineering to marketing and product management. Before joining NVP, Mr. Abbott was at Silicon Graphics. Prior to Silicon Graphics, Mr. Abbott worked at IBM-ROLM Systems.
He holds B.S and M.S. degrees in Electrical Engineering and an MBA, all from Stanford University.

Kace Expands Board of Directors and Secures Additional Funding
Sigma Partners and Pete Solvik, Former Cisco CIO, Back KACE
MOUNTAIN VIEW, Calif. - July 25, 2005 - KACE, creator of a family of turnkey IT automation appliances, today announced that it has added Pete Solvik, former senior vice president and CIO of Cisco Systems, to its Board of Directors and secured an additional $3 million in funding. Top venture capital firm, Sigma Partners (over $1 billion under management), led the financing round with additional participation and support from private investors. The new investment will support the company's efforts to meet the growing demand and launch of innovative new products in the field of IT automation.
KACE is led by CEO, Rob Meinhardt, former vice president of marketing at mobile computing pioneer, AvantGo, Inc., now a Sybase subsidiary. In addition to Meinhardt, KACE's Board of Directors includes KACE founder Marty Kacin and Pete Solvik of Sigma Partners. Prior to founding KACE and joining the board, Kacin co-founded and served as CTO at AvantGo. Solvik served as CIO at Cisco from 1994 -- 2001, was named to CIO Magazine's "CIO 100" four times, and was chosen as one of the "25 most powerful executives in Networking" by Network World.
"We believe that this round of investment reflects an important endorsement of our company and our product strategy--to deliver the highest-quality appliance coupled with superior customer service to ensure the greatest value per IT dollar spent," said Rob Meinhardt, CEO, KACE. "Pete's support coupled with his reputation as one Americas great CIO innovators speaks to the important benefits that KACE is bringing to its customers."
"Businesses now more than ever depend on their IT infrastructure to keep their businesses productive. Yet, IT organizations are faced with fewer financial and human resources to get the job done," said Pete Solvik, managing director, Sigma Partners. "KACE captured my attention with its fresh approach to this problem. They resolve the resource and cost issues with comprehensive yet affordable products that improve an IT organization's ability to efficiently and securely manage their infrastructure."
